## Service Accounts — StormFan Alert Fan-Out

The fan-out worker authenticates to the internal dispatch tier using the svc-stormfan account. Rotate quarterly; scopes are limited to publish-only on alert topics. If deliveries stall during your shift, verify the worker is using the current credential, reproduced below for reference.

API key for kaweg-hahif: kto4_rAjZ

### Handover — Queue-Depth Autoscaler (Brimhall Workers)

Handing this off before my rotation ends. The autoscaler watches the ingest queue and scales the Brimhall worker fleet between its floor and ceiling. Last week we raised the scale-down cooldown after a flapping incident, so don't be surprised by slower drawdowns. Everything else is stock. The autoscaler currently runs with the configuration below.

settings of fafog-haduf:
ZORIX_PIN=4648
ZORIX_METRICS_HOST=metrics.zorix.paliqsys.corp
ZORIX_LOG_LEVEL=info
ZORIX_TENANT=druix

Action item from the Wrenhall Gallery audio-guide postmortem: the TourStream app cached stale exhibit manifests after the midnight sync job failed silently, leaving visitors with mismatched narration for three hours. Please review the retry wrapper in the manifest fetcher carefully — it swallows timeout exceptions and logs them at debug level only, which is why nothing alerted. We want the fix to raise on the third failure and page on-call. The full incident timeline and logs are posted on the internal wiki page below.

wiki page, yajof-tafof: https://confluence.lumiclabs.internal/display/projects/projects/projects

Cold starts on the Plinkway handlers are killing p99. Don't bump memory blindly — pre-warm via the scheduler and keep the init block lean. Imports outside the handler, lazy-load the Quarrel client. If you touch provisioned concurrency, get a sign-off from Mirela first. The constants we tuned last sprint are below.

tuning table, kajog-bawip:
TIERS = {
    "kelius": 256,
    "lammir": 543,
}

Subject: Rebalancer handover

Hi — taking over Pedalsort from me as of Friday. The rebalancing tool reads station fill levels every five minutes and writes move orders to the dispatch table. Cron runs on the ops box; logs rotate weekly. Don't touch the forecast schema, that's the analytics team's. Credentials for the primary database are below.

replica DSN, kajep-yahag: mssql://praok_svc:iF@db-8d68.plorvaio.local:5432/eliion